Battery Problems

The battery of a key fob can quickly deplete in the event that it is not replaced on time. The key repair shops Near me fob will not be able to communicate anymore with your vehicle, which can be a problem if you want to use the key fob to unlock doors or use a push button to start the engine. It is easy to change the battery on most modern key fobs. It is essential to first ensure that you use the appropriate type of battery (a multimeter can be helpful in this case). A CR2032 is a typical size used in a lot of key fobs. However, it is always best to refer to the owner's manual or check online for the right battery to use. It is essential to test the battery in order to ensure that the key fob is working correctly.

If you find that you need to click the key fob button multiple times before it locks and unlocks, the battery is low. It should be replaced immediately if it is possible. A damaged battery could cause the key fob to lose memory and not respond when it is pressed even if it's a fresh replacement.

If you have to hold the key fob closer to your vehicle in order to get it unlocked It could be time to replace the battery on your keyfob. A working key fob will usually work from a distance of around 20 feet, while an unresponsive one can only function at a close distance.

Reprograming Problems

If you're having a problem other than a dead battery, or if you're locked out of your car It could be that the key fob you have to be reprogrammed. If you're not familiar with this procedure, you'll want to find a company that is experienced with it, as doing it wrong can cause the key fob to not functioning or even causing damage to your vehicle.

Transponder keys are required in most newer cars. They are equipped with an electronic radio chip. This chip transmits a unique signal when it's inserted into the ignition of the car. This signal helps your mobile car key repair recognize keys and allow you to unlock the doors or start the engine. It's vital that the chip inside your transponder key has been programmed correctly for it to perform as it should.

When it comes time to reprogram a key fob, it's usually best to leave it to an auto key fob repair dealer or a shop that is specialized in the model and make of your car perform the task. Many independent shops do not have the necessary equipment to program specific models that are newer. A faulty key fob can be the result of a simple issue with the battery. However, other problems can be encountered that could be more difficult to identify and solve. Keep spare batteries or a backup keyfob in case yours breaks.

Another common issue with a key fob is a lack of range. If you find that your vehicle has to be in close proximity to the key fob in order to open it or start it, it could be an indication that the battery is dying. It can also happen when you need to press the button a few times before your vehicle begins.

If changing the batteries doesn't solve the issue You can try taking your key fob apart to do a visual check. The battery connector terminals may break. Examining them and carefully reconnecting them can allow your key fob to work once more. You can also adjust any buttons that appear to be stuck or damaged but this will generally require expert attention.
